This is an African folk story told backwards. In most countries in Africa, the Tortoise is always a Hero in the African Children's stories, and the Tortoise is always cheating its way out of any jam. Tortoise always out smarts its colleagues and never pays for any wrong doings. We need to change this Tortoise behavior so that our children will begin to understand that there is a price to pay for doing bad things or for trying to even cheat. Today, in almost the whole face of Africa, if you cheat your way and make it, your own people will crown you a king to recon with. So here it is, Tortoise is going to get some punishment for doing something not so cool with his friends. Maybe it will begin to sink in, that this hero is not so cool after all.
